Understanding the Seat Belt Warning System

Before we dive into troubleshooting, it’s essential to grasp how the seat belt warning system operates. The system comprises several components working in tandem:

  • Seat Belt Buckles: These house sensors that detect when a seat belt is fastened.
  • Seat Belt Pretensioners: These activate during a collision to tighten the seat belts, ensuring occupants are held securely.
  • Warning Light and Chime: Located on the dashboard, the warning light illuminates, and the chime sounds to alert the driver of an unbuckled seat belt.

When the ignition is turned on, the system performs a self-check. If a fault is detected, the warning light may stay illuminated even if all seat belts are fastened.

Common Causes of a 2012 Freightliner Seat Belt Warning Light

Several factors can trigger the seat belt warning light in your 2012 Freightliner:

1. Unbuckled Seat Belt

The most obvious reason is an unbuckled seat belt. Always ensure that you and your passengers have fastened their seat belts correctly before starting your journey.

2. Faulty Seat Belt Buckle

Over time, seat belt buckles can wear out or become damaged, leading to a faulty sensor. A damaged buckle might not register that the seat belt is fastened, causing the warning light to remain on.

3. Damaged Wiring Harness

The wiring harness connecting the seat belt buckle sensors to the vehicle’s electrical system can become frayed, corroded, or damaged. This disruption in the electrical circuit can trigger a false warning light.

4. Seat Belt Warning Light Malfunction

While less common, the warning light itself can malfunction. A short circuit or a blown bulb in the instrument cluster can cause the light to stay on permanently.

5. Software Glitch

Modern vehicles like the 2012 Freightliner heavily rely on software. A software glitch within the airbag control module or related systems can disrupt the seat belt warning system, leading to an inaccurate warning light.

Troubleshooting the Seat Belt Warning Light

Before heading to a mechanic, you can try these troubleshooting steps:

  1. Check All Seat Belts: Ensure all seat belts, including the passenger and sleeper berth, are securely fastened.
  2. Inspect Seat Belt Buckles: Visually inspect each buckle for any signs of damage, debris, or loose connections.
  3. Check the Wiring: Carefully examine the wiring harness under the seats for any signs of damage, wear, or loose connections.
  4. Try Resetting the System: Disconnect the battery’s negative terminal for a few minutes, then reconnect it. This can sometimes reset the system and clear any temporary glitches.
